Heads up: CI jobs for Wrenfold occasionally fail with "host not found" on the artifact mirror. It's flaky DNS on the runner pool, not your change — retries usually clear it. If a customer asks, the fix (resolver cache pinning) is rolling out this week. When escalating, quote the identifier from the failed job, shown below.

trace token, kahog-hadup: htk9_337a55b4e

Handover Note – Loyalty Programme Overhaul

From outgoing Director T. Marroway to incoming Director S. Quill. The Lanternpoint overhaul is at phase two: points migration complete, tier redesign pending sign-off. Heads of department have the revised redemption rules; rollout training starts next month. Vendor Cresthaven is contracted through year-end. Watch the churn figures in the Eastvale region. The strategic rationale for the next phase is summarised below.

internal memo for kawip-hadug: Headcount on the Wenwyn team goes from 7 to 140 by the end of January. Gross margin on Wenwyn came in at 20 percent against a plan of 15 percent.

Subject: Template rendering — quick heads-up before your first shift

Hey, welcome to the rotation! Quick note ahead of the weekly eng sync: the Quillet rendering tier has been flirting with its p95 budget since the Marbrook theme launch. If you get paged, it's almost always cache churn on partials, not the renderer itself. Flushing the fragment cache buys time; don't restart workers first. We'll walk through it Thursday, but the dashboard and runbook are kept here.

operations page: https://jenkins.zemvarcloud.local/job/merge_requests/repo/build/73930b4b30f0a8ed

## Approvals for Role-Based Access

Welcome to the Fernwick wiki. Access is governed by three roles: Reader, Contributor, and Steward. New members start as Readers automatically. Contributor requests require a completed onboarding checklist and a sponsor on your team. Steward access is granted only for spaces you maintain, and requests are reviewed weekly. Never share credentials to bypass this process; it invalidates the audit trail. All role elevation requests must be approved by the person named below.

approver of yahif-hahif = Wenwyn Eliael